Shhh by Raymond Federman
The Story of a Childhood
In this avant-garde narrative, the story unfolds through a series of fragmented memories and surreal episodes, exploring the complexities of identity and the fluidity of time. The protagonist, a writer, grapples with the echoes of his past and the elusive nature of truth, as he navigates a world where reality and fiction intertwine. Through a playful yet poignant prose, the narrative challenges conventional storytelling, inviting readers to question the boundaries between the spoken and the unspoken, the remembered and the forgotten.
